The Siemens SIDAC 4EU3032-0MG08-0AA0 is a 3-phase filter reactor, rated 98.3 A at 480 V AC, 60 Hz. It delivers 80 kvar of reactive power and carries a 7% relative throttling factor, meaning it smooths line harmonics and limits inrush current for drives and other non-linear loads. Thermal class H (IEC 60085) means the winding insulation handles sustained heat up to 180 °C — built for continuous duty in a closed cabinet.
IP00 means it's an open-frame reactor — no enclosure, no washdown rating. It mounts inside a ventilated electrical panel, not on the floor or outdoors. Terminals are flat-type screw connectors, so you'll land lugs or fork terminals, not spring cages. Dimensions: 0.3 m wide, 0.269 m tall, 0.211 m deep — measure your panel depth before committing.
The 109 A maximum is the peak current the reactor can handle without saturating; the 98.3 A rated value is the continuous design point at 40 °C ambient. The 0.00058 H inductance at 60 Hz gives the 7% impedance that limits harmonic currents. Resonant frequency of 227 Hz means it's tuned to avoid resonance with the drive's switching frequency in most 6-pulse applications.
